What is a quant research internship?

A Quant Research Internship involves using mathematical, statistical, and programming skills to analyze financial data and develop trading strategies. Interns work with quantitative researchers and traders to identify patterns, test models, and optimize algorithms. The role typically requires proficiency in programming languages like Python or C++, a strong foundation in probability and statistics, and knowledge of financial markets.

What types of projects or responsibilities can I expect as a quant research intern?

As a Quant Research Intern, you can expect to work on projects involving quantitative analysis, data cleaning and processing, statistical modeling, and assisting in the development and backtesting of trading strategies. Your daily responsibilities may include collaborating with full-time quantitative researchers, analyzing large datasets, and presenting your findings to your team. You’ll likely work with programming languages such as Python or R, and may utilize statistical or machine learning techniques. This hands-on experience provides valuable insight into the workflow of quantitative research and is an excellent stepping stone for pursuing full-time roles in the industry.

Equity Quantitative Research (EQR) seeks to capitalize on market inefficiencies identified through a combination of structural analysis, leading-edge quantitative research and technology. The team trades billions of dollars a day by applying statistics, computer science and economic principles.

EQR manages several systematic and semi-systematic equities strategies in addition to equities trading. Every investment idea or trade requires an understanding of market flows, sophisticated mathematics and large-scale data analysis.

The Role

As a Quantitative Trader your core mandate is to optimize trading strategies to maximize profitability. You will decide how capital is allocated and risk is deployed across signals and strategies, tuning the portfolio so that every unit of risk earns as much as possible. You will work side by side with quantitative researchers and engineers to translate research into production strategies that trade real capital - by working to improve the optimizer, model and minimize trading costs and market impact, and manage capacity and financing.

You will own portfolio-level risk as a first line of defense - reasoning about exposures, intervening tactically as conditions change, and doing research and statistical analysis to continuously push the portfolio's risk-adjusted returns higher. This is a high-ownership seat where you make decisions under time constraints, mentored by leaders who have realized PnL at scale.

Your Objectives:

  • Partner with quantitative researchers and engineers to turn research into production trading strategies.
  • Conduct research to find where the portfolio is leaving money on the table and to generate additional returns from existing strategies.
  • Manage portfolio-level risk and exposures in real time, adapting allocation as market conditions change to protect and grow PnL.
  • Continuously monitor strategy performance, diagnose issues, and iterate to keep strategies performing across market regimes.

Your Skills & Talents:

  • A strong interest in game theory, decision theory, and strategy games, and the instinct to apply them to markets.
  • Effective problem-solving skills and the rigor to reason about optimization, risk, and profitability from first principles - with the judgment to know where the next dollar of PnL comes from.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• A self-starter who is not afraid to question the status quo.
  • A degree from a top university in a quantitative field such as statistics, mathematics, computer science, or physics - strong candidates often bring graduate research or competition experience.
